Uganda mission trips to be discussed

Former Albany youth minister Thomas Aly with Live Missions will host an informational meeting this Sunday, Sept. 23, at 3:00 p.m. at The Feed Store, for anyone who is interested in finding out more about the non-profit’s upcoming Uganda mission trips.

Aly has a trip planned for March 5 through March 15, 2019 and another trip in the works for July 9 to July 20.

“If you’re at all interested, mark your calendars and come join us,” Aly said. “Go and like our Live Missions page to stay updated.”

Live Missions partners with pastors across the world to implement a discipleship program in churches where there is a void, according to Aly.

“In Uganda, you will get the opportunity to work with God’s Way Church as well as Heritage Junior School,” said Aly. “Live Missions uses Heritage Junior School as a central hub for our evangelism outreach. Teams will get the opportunity to walk the area of the Wakiso District and share the love of Jesus Christ.”
